Output 31b7e9c29db2ab80f500383a4f8cccdb78311bb726e251184c678258f2aad21c:1

value
19411756
script pubkey
OP_0 OP_PUSHBYTES_20 04594d8c3c0d9524e4c90f45be6087ebf591c26e
address
bc1qq3v5mrpupk2jfexfpazmucy8a06ersnwsxfh7a
transaction
31b7e9c29db2ab80f500383a4f8cccdb78311bb726e251184c678258f2aad21c